Why Manhattan Construction Requires a Specialized Approach

Building in Manhattan is unlike building almost anywhere else in the country. Tight lot lines, vertical construction, landmark preservation rules, and constant pedestrian traffic create challenges that demand more than general experience. As a result, property owners and developers need a contractor who understands the borough’s specific regulatory and logistical landscape.

Additionally, Manhattan’s neighborhoods each carry their own zoning quirks and construction considerations. A project in Tribeca, with its historic cast-iron buildings, requires a different approach than a high-rise build in Hudson Yards. Similarly, a renovation on the Upper East Side may involve co-op board approvals that a Midtown commercial buildout would never face. Questions to Ask Before Hiring a General Contractor in Manhattan

Before signing a contract, property owners and developers should ask a few key questions to evaluate whether a contractor is truly equipped to handle a Manhattan project:

  • Has the contractor completed projects in similar neighborhoods, such as Hudson Yards, Tribeca, or the Upper West Side?
  • What is their track record on completion timelines and budget adherence?
  • Do they offer integrated pre-construction and entitlement services, or only general construction?
  • How do they manage subcontractor coordination and quality control?
  • What safety protocols are in place, and how are they enforced on-site?

Asking these questions upfront can prevent costly surprises later. Consequently, a contractor who answers confidently and transparently, backed by a real project history, is far more likely to deliver a smooth build.
